The Space Policy Show is pleased to hear from special guest Alan Ladwig, author of "See you in Orbit? Our Dream of Spaceflight", and host Dr. Angie Bukley (Aerospace) as they discuss the early days of NASA’s astronaut recruitment efforts. Alan will discuss his research on the historical struggle for women and Black Americans to gain a seat in space. Tune in to find out more!
The Space Policy Show is produced by The Aerospace Corporation’s Center for Space Policy and Strategy. It is a virtual series covering a broad set of topics that span across the space enterprise. CSPS brings together experts from within Aerospace, the government, academia, business, nonprofits, and the national labs. The show and their podcasts are an opportunity to learn about and to stay engaged with the larger space policy community.
